Recruitment has always been one of the most critical functions for businesses, regardless of size or industry. With competition for top talent intensifying, organizations are under pressure to make smarter hiring decisions, reduce costs, and improve efficiency. Traditionally, recruitment relied on manual processes — posting job ads, reviewing resumes by hand, and coordinating interviews through emails and spreadsheets. While this method has worked for years, it is increasingly proving inefficient in a digital-first world.

Enter Applicant Tracking Software (ATS), a powerful solution designed to streamline the recruitment process. But how does it stack up against traditional recruiting when it comes to delivering a better return on investment (ROI)? Let’s break it down.


1. Cost and Time Efficiency

Traditional recruiting often involves extensive manual work, from resume screening to coordinating interviews. This not only takes longer but also incurs higher labor costs. In contrast, Applicant Tracking Software automates repetitive tasks such as resume parsing, candidate ranking, and interview scheduling. By significantly reducing the time-to-hire, ATS ensures that positions are filled quickly, lowering the cost of prolonged vacancies.


2. Quality of Hire

With traditional recruiting, quality can be inconsistent due to reliance on manual judgment and limited access to candidate data. Applicant Tracking Systems leverage advanced features like keyword-based resume searches, AI-driven screening, and skill matching to identify top talent faster and more accurately. By providing hiring managers with deeper insights, ATS improves the chances of making the right hire the first time.


3. Collaboration and Transparency

Traditional recruitment methods often result in communication silos — emails get lost, feedback is delayed, and decisions take longer. Applicant Tracking Software offers centralized platforms where hiring teams can collaborate seamlessly. Real-time updates, notes, and evaluation tools ensure everyone stays aligned, leading to quicker and more effective decision-making.


4. Scalability

As businesses grow, recruitment demands also increase. Traditional processes struggle to scale, often leading to bottlenecks. ATS platforms, however, are built for scalability. Whether hiring for 5 roles or 500, Applicant Tracking Systems adapt to business needs, ensuring recruitment processes remain consistent and efficient.


5. Data-Driven Insights

One of the biggest advantages of Applicant Tracking Software over traditional recruiting is data analytics. ATS platforms generate detailed reports on key metrics such as time-to-hire, cost-per-hire, and source effectiveness. These insights empower businesses to refine strategies, optimize budgets, and improve long-term recruitment ROI — something traditional methods simply cannot match.
